University of Wisconsin-Madison is hiring a Graduate Program Recruiter and Admissions Coach

About the Role

The position focuses on attracting qualified applicants to graduate programs by managing recruitment initiatives, providing application guidance, and building relationships with academic departments and underrepresented communities.

Responsibilities

  • Identify and engage potential graduate students through targeted outreach campaigns
  • Conduct one-on-one advising sessions with applicants on program fit and application requirements
  • Represent the institution at academic conferences, recruitment events, and virtual fairs
  • Develop and distribute recruitment materials tailored to specific disciplines
  • Collaborate with faculty and program coordinators to understand enrollment goals
  • Maintain accurate records of recruitment activities and applicant interactions
  • Assist in evaluating admissions data to assess outreach effectiveness
  • Support diversity recruitment efforts by connecting with pipeline programs
  • Respond to inquiries from prospective students via email, phone, and online platforms
  • Organize campus visit schedules for admitted student events
  • Provide training for graduate program staff on recruitment best practices
  • Create content for social media and newsletters to engage applicant pools
  • Track application trends and report findings to leadership
  • Coordinate logistics for information sessions and open houses
  • Foster relationships with domestic and international academic partners
  • Advise applicants on prerequisite coursework and credential evaluation
  • Assist in streamlining admissions workflows and communication templates
  • Promote interdisciplinary graduate opportunities to broad audiences
  • Ensure compliance with institutional and program-specific admissions policies
  • Use CRM tools to manage applicant pipelines and follow-up tasks
